Gentoo Archives: gentoo-user-de

From: assabajanischer_hinterwaeldler@×××××.de
To: gentoo-user-de@l.g.o
Subject: Re: [gentoo-user-de] Binärpackete libreoffice-bin dependencies
Date: Tue, 06 Aug 2013 09:20:11
Message-Id: 20130806111951.Horde.ijDwYjyVyWNzEgiuyzkPyg1@webmail.xunit.de
In Reply to: [gentoo-user-de] Binärpackete libreoffice-bin dependencies by Michael Volland
1 Hallo,
2
3 nicht schön, aber du kannst den ebuild modifizieren, sofern du dir
4 sicher bist, dass es nichts ausmacht. Dort die entsprechendenden
5 dependenacys entfernen und signieren.
6 Alternativ dazu und deutlich schoener koennte folgendes helfen:
7 Trage in die /var/lib/portage/world folgendes ein
8 <virtual/jpeg-0-r2
9
10 sofern keine paket explizit die jpeg-0-r2 oder neuer benoetigt, macht
11 dies keinen unterschied.
12 virtual/jpeg-0 benoetigt ausschliesslich:
13 >=media-libs/libjpeg-turbo-1.2.0:0[static-libs?]. somit passt das.
14
15 zusaetzlich solltest du noch einen entsprechenden bug report
16 eintragen, dass entwickler das auch sehen (mit dem hinweis auf ~amd64)
17
18 das ganze musst du allerdings im auge behalten, da mit einer neueren
19 version der binary dies nicht mehr funktioniert.
20 evtl lassen sich auch beide ansaetze kombinieren:
21 dazu musst du die abhaengigkeit '<virtual/jpeg-0-r2' in den
22 libreoffice ebuild eintragen.
23
24 gruss
25 martin
26
27 original text from Michael Volland <mk106c-gnu@×××××.de> written on
28 Di, 06 Aug 2013
29
30 > Hallo,
31 >
32 > kann man emerge zwingen ein Binär-Paket installieren ohne dass
33 > alle Abhängigkeiten erfüllt sind?
34 >
35 > Ich habe libreoffice-bin deinstalliert, da ich gelesen hatte:
36 >
37 > Instead, I'm going to guess that the version of the dependency is tied
38 > to the bin package at install time and that portage doesn't deal with
39 > this case. i.e. during the @preserve-rebuild emerge.
40 > Quelle:
41 > http://forums.gentoo.org/viewtopic-p-7365494.html
42 >
43 > Folgendes sagt emerge nun (gekürzt):
44 >
45 > virtual/jpeg-0-r2: >=media-libs/libjpeg-turbo-1.3.0-r2:0 und
46 >
47 > app-office/libreoffice-bin-4.0.4.2::gentoo
48 > <media-libs/libjpeg-turbo-1.3.0-r2
49 >
50 > Habs nicht geschafft das aufzulösen.
51 >
52 > /etc/portage/make.conf:
53 > ACCEPT_KEYWORDS="~amd64"
54 >
55 > Gruß
56 > Michael

Replies

Subject Author
Re: [gentoo-user-de] Binärpackete libreoffice-bin dependencies Michael Volland <mk106c-gnu@×××××.de>